Dual Fuel Ranges Recalled Due to Risk of Serious Injury or Death from Fire or Explosion Hazards; Manufactured by AGA Rangemaster
CPSC recall 26756 · announced September 10, 2026 · Aga Rangemaster Limited · 3,992 units affected
The product
This recall involves freestanding AGA Elise and Mercury Series Dual Fuel Ranges, in 36- and 48-inch widths and freestanding La Cornue CornuFé Series Dual Fuel Ranges in 36- and 43-inch widths manufactured between March 19, 2025 and July 24, 2026. All units have gas surface burners, set for Natural or LP gas, with one to three electric ovens depending on size. The products are sold in stainless steel, white and 13 other colors, which can be found at www.agarangeusa.com and www.lacornueusa.com. All colors, trim options and gas types (Natural or LP) are included. The serial number is on the rating plate, which is located on the bottom panel of the unit under the storage drawer.
The hazard
Dual Fuel Ranges with a missing cap from the gas test port can cause a gas leak, posing a risk of serious injury or death from fire or explosion hazards.
What to do (per CPSC)
Repair Remedy type: Consumers should shut off the gas supply to avoid the risk of gas leak immediately and contact AGA Rangemaster. Consumers should promptly determine if their range is subject to recall by locating the model/serial number on the rating plate (on the bottom panel under the storage drawer) and visiting the Recall webpage at www.lacornueusa.com/testcap-recall or www.agarangeusa.com/testcap-recall. If subject to the recall, consumers should contact AGA Rangemaster for a free inspection and repair by a certified technician. Consumers can continue to use only the electric oven sections of the range. The gas surface burners cannot be used.
Notes
Incidents (per CPSC): None reported.
Sold at: Authorized appliance dealers nationwide from March 2025 through July 2026 for about $6,000 to $20,000.
